Analysis of Gallery of Words
A quick grasp on her beloved pen
Same energy just like back then
Paper, ink, and a cup of tea
New horizon to explore and see
Cluster of words quite entangled
Voluntarily they just mingled
In search of their rightful place
Longing for a warm embrace
It’s that time
A moment
A play of rhyme
A statement
A sparkling space
Glimmer of hope
An endless chase
Utopia to grope
In between all of that a line will form
Creating emotions of storm
Words with shadows that silently scream
Empowering feelings of a lost dream
It can trigger unfamiliar tears
It leaves a mark like that of spears
Random alphabets can make you crave
A simple stanza could make you brave
There’s no limit on what you’re capable
Everywhere you go there can be trouble
You may find light or be trapped in a maze
Ambiguity could set your heart ablaze
It’s the art of writing
A message to convey
An act of believing
A home to stay
A pair of sturdy wings to fly
Unsaid meaningful goodbye
A speck of light
An instance to try
Through day and night
A desire to cry
There’s no need for me to explain it further
When you yourself knows well the danger
She can win a battle without those swords
As long as she owns that gallery of words!
